Hello all,

I've been into bikes all my life starting off ayt age 9 with trials on a ty80. I didn't pass my road license until 23 with a ZX6R as first road bike, then a new GSXR750 in 04. The worst decision I ever made was selling that bike (house/kids, you know the story), so bike less for a year or two then I got a bargain in the form of a RSV Mille R.
I have been hankering after an original R1 4XV for several years, always watching them becoming more expensive, especially when MCN do a full page spread on them. So funds allowed and last month i purchased the R1 1998 in red and white. Best decision I ever made, very happy with purchase and view it as an investment that I can enjoy.
A few things to tidy up on it to put it back to original condition, the wheels are white so those to return to black, the rear fairing has a Yamaha graphic in the wrong place and the foot peg hangers have been polished. The clutch cover needs replacing due to damage from the bike falling over at some point but other than that its in great condition.

heres a few tips about the 4xv & 5jj also how to post pic's !
"Those 4xv's are a lovely bike , they share a lot of parts with the 5jj like frame, wheels & engines are similar , things that are different are ECU , bodywork i.e. tank , fairing , seat unit & headlight also the radiator & wiring looms are different .
Make sure you look in the 4xv & 5jj sections .
Check the main 20pin white plug on the wiring loom that sits behind the left hand fairing to make sure its in good order & been greased as these can cause problems , the HT leads can break up when old where the plug cap screws on & cause misfire all you need to do is cut 5-10 mm off the end & screw the cap back on , also DON'T tighten the sump bolt up to 42nm its a lot less more like 15-20nm .
get the service manuals and parts micro fiches for both the 4xv & 5jj downloaded , use the online PDF link & down load the parts manuals from there .
